The Lenovo ThinkPad X1 Carbon 2026 and the Dell Latitude 9440 are two of the most anticipated business laptops of the year. They both aim to combine performance, portability, and innovative features to meet the needs of professionals worldwide.
Design and Build Quality
The ThinkPad X1 Carbon 2026 continues Lenovo’s tradition of sleek, durable design. It features a magnesium and carbon fiber chassis that offers both strength and lightness, making it ideal for on-the-go use. Its minimalist aesthetic is complemented by a robust hinge mechanism that ensures longevity.
Meanwhile, the Dell Latitude 9440 boasts a premium aluminum chassis with a modern, slim profile. Its design emphasizes elegance and professionalism, with a focus on portability. The build quality is reinforced with military-grade durability standards, ensuring resilience in various environments.
Performance and Hardware
The ThinkPad X1 Carbon 2026 is powered by the latest Intel Core processors, offering options up to i7 and advanced integrated graphics. It comes with ample RAM (up to 32GB) and fast SSD storage, ensuring smooth multitasking and quick data access.
The Dell Latitude 9440 features similar high-performance hardware, with Intel’s latest generation processors, up to 64GB of RAM, and PCIe SSD options. Its hardware configuration is tailored for demanding business applications and multitasking.
Display and Graphics
The ThinkPad X1 Carbon 2026 offers a 14-inch display with options for 4K OLED, ensuring vibrant colors and sharp images. Its anti-reflective coating enhances usability in bright environments.
The Dell Latitude 9440 features a 14-inch display with a choice of Full HD or 4K resolution. Its touchscreen option provides added flexibility for interactive tasks, making it suitable for presentations and creative work.
Keyboard, Trackpad, and Input
Lenovo’s ThinkPad series is renowned for its keyboard quality, and the X1 Carbon 2026 continues this tradition with a comfortable, responsive keyboard that is ideal for long typing sessions.
The Dell Latitude 9440 features a well-designed keyboard with good key travel and feedback. Its precision touchpad and optional stylus support enhance productivity and creativity.
Connectivity and Ports
The ThinkPad X1 Carbon 2026 offers a comprehensive selection of ports, including Thunderbolt 4, USB-A, HDMI, and an audio jack, ensuring compatibility with various peripherals.
The Dell Latitude 9440 also provides multiple connectivity options, including Thunderbolt 4, USB-C, HDMI, and an SD card reader, catering to diverse professional needs.
Battery Life and Security
The ThinkPad X1 Carbon 2026 is equipped with a high-capacity battery that can last up to 15 hours under typical usage, with fast charging capabilities.
The Dell Latitude 9440 offers comparable battery life, with some configurations achieving around 14 hours. Security features include fingerprint readers, IR cameras for facial recognition, and enterprise-grade encryption.
Software and Additional Features
Lenovo’s ThinkPad X1 Carbon 2026 comes with Windows 11 Pro pre-installed and includes features like ThinkShield security suite and Lenovo’s productivity tools.
Dell’s Latitude 9440 runs Windows 11 Pro and offers additional features such as Dell Optimizer AI, which enhances performance and battery management based on user habits.
